Keating Estates are proud to present this charming one-bedroom garden flat, set on the raised ground floor of an elegant Victorian conversion, blending period character with modern living.
As you approach the property, the handsome Victorian façade sets a welcoming tone, offering instant kerb appeal with its classic brickwork and decorative detailing, smart black railings and pretty blue door.
A cosy reception room is located at the front of the property, with a charming bay and sash windows flooding the room with natural light and accentuating the high ceilings, enhancing the sense of openness. Contributing to the feel of character, this reception benefits from a feature fireplace and attractive cornicing. In the alcoves there are built-in cupboards and shelving, providing excellent storage and space for displaying artwork or books. This versatile room is ideal for both entertaining and everyday relaxation, easily accommodating a dining area alongside a comfortable lounge set-up.
Opposite the reception lies the bedroom, which offers a peaceful retreat set away from the street. With a large sash window offering a pleasant garden outlook, this well-proportioned room provides ample space for a double bed and additional furnishings such as wardrobes or a dressing table.
Conveniently located between the bedroom and the reception is a contemporary bathroom with a walk-in shower.
The bright and practical kitchen sits toward the rear of the flat and is designed to make the most of its space, featuring modern cabinetry in a soft pastel finish complemented by warm wooden worktops. With ample cupboard storage, a double sink and space for appliances, the layout is highly functional and well-suited for everyday cooking. A large window and glazed back door flood the room with natural light, creating a welcoming atmosphere while offering pleasant views. The door opens directly onto the private garden, providing an ideal connection between indoor and outdoor living.
One of the most appealing features of this property is its generous private garden, accessed directly from the kitchen. Offering a tranquil outdoor retreat, it is ideal for relaxing or entertaining. Surrounded by mature planting and greenery, it provides both privacy and a natural backdrop throughout the seasons. A gravelled area offers the perfect spot for al fresco dining, with space for an outdoor table and chairs. Well-established shrubs and trees add character and a sense of seclusion, making this garden a delightful extension of the home and a peaceful escape from city life.
The flat’s raised ground-floor position also brings a sense of privacy and security, with an abundance of light flowing throughout.
For further peace of mind, the roof was fully replaced in 2024 and is covered by a 15-year guarantee, while the windows throughout the property were upgraded to high-quality double glazing in 2022, enhancing both energy efficiency and comfort.
